#598625 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#598625 is composed of 34.9% red, 52.5% green and 14.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 33.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 72.4% yellow and 47.5% black. It has a hue angle of 87.8 degrees, a saturation of 56.7% and a lightness of 33.5%. #598625 color hex could be obtained by blending #b2ff4a with #000d00. Closest websafe color is: #669933.

Shades and Tints of #598625

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#070b03 is the darkest color, while #fcfefb is the lightest one.

Tones of #598625

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#565853 is the less saturated color, while #5ba704 is the most saturated one.
